Meg Whitman's former maid gets $5,500 in back wages

By Joe Rodriguez
jrodriquez@mercurynews.com
Posted: 11/17/2010 04:38:12 PM PST
Updated: 11/17/2010 04:38:13 PM PST

Ending an ordeal that may have doomed her race for governor, Meg Whitman on Wednesday agreed to pay her former maid back wages of $5,500, an amount dwarfed by the political fallout created when the illegal-immigrant housekeeper came out of the shadows to accuse the billionaire of cheating her ...
